Card Base: I cut my flower background fractionally smaller than the front of my card in the same colour and glued into place to imitate an embossed look except with a sharper/crisper edge. Instead of placing my sentiment onto my card front I decided to add it inside the card and create a window in the front, I cut the opening with a spellbinders die and used 2 dies to cut a narrow frame to add a neat finish to the edge of the circle window.
Flowers: I used the flower and leaf cut file for my vellum flowers, I ran an embossing stylus over the back of the petals to add some shape then popped some sparkles into the middles. I wanted my sparkles to be a deeper shade of purple so I dabbed them with the chisel end of a copic marker and they took the colour fantastically so I’ll definitely do that again!
